A perfect place to grab a quick, inexpensive but satisfying meal. All of their food for the day are prepared and put on display. When you order, they just take a portion and heat it up in the microwave before serving. What you get is very quick service for homey, comforting dishes. We thoroughly enjoyed the snails, callos, and mushrooms. It's a great place to eat hot, flavorful stews especially during the cold autumn/winter nights.

Super awesome place for very traditional basque stews. The desserts are great too and what's really nice is that the menu is only a list of all the options they ever have, what they'll have on the day, you'll see (they'll have most things, to be fair). Prices are super decent too and the stews are oh so great. Absolutely recommend this place for anyone looking to experience real basque fare.
